About this section:

The meaning of this section is to keep you street team-ians up to date of what's going on, of course. You can start topics for your own language if you wish so, but it would be nice if everything was written in English so the band, management and of course, me :roll: could follow the conversation.

Of course, separate topics for separate countries is a wise thing to do.

Nothing much to add right now! Have fun, keep the conversation and the ideas flowing! :)

You can contact me (and when needed, the band & the management) by sending an e-mail to:
streetteams@poetsofthefall.com!

Jariq wrote:
The Absolution wrote:
For Germany and Finland it has started, but other countries are still in the beginning of all this! Why not help them?


To me it seems quite logical considering that CoR will be released soon in Germany and Potf has (so far) had most of the gigs in Finland and Germany. Of course helping the other countries is good too, but I don't think it's a great idea to spread a lot of fliers etc. (which cost money) in countries where the album isn't released and where Potf isn't going to have gigs very soon.


Well, Jariq pretty much said it all :) at first, the other countries should maybe concentrate in this online promoting - MySpace, forums, whatever you feel like :) also, radio requests are never useless! Even if they didn't play the songs right away, the band's name will still stick to their heads and that may be useful in the near future! At least that's what I think.

Sending over some flyers isn't that cheap (and we still have to keep in mind POTF doesn't have a million dollars they got from a record company to do all this) and we have to concentrate on countries where they are needed the most.

Does that make any sense to you? :)

Little by little we will conquer the world! :D
